texte = >Hi All, > >Can anyone suggest a solution to my problem. > >I'm using the loop command to append multiple records to a database with a >single user action. I want to use the cart command to generate a new SKU >for each record generated by the loop command. > >The looping works fine and the appending works fine, but I can't figure out >how to get a new SKU for each record ? > >The code I am using is listed below. > >[loop start=1&end=[number]&advance=1] >[append >db=photos.db]sku=[cart]&url=[entrydate.form]&preview=sml[index].jpg[/append] >Record [index] added
>[/loop] > > > >Thanks in advance. > >Tim Rignold > If I'm right using the [cart] like that is going to give you the same sku. If you are just using an ordered sku like 1 - 100 why not get the last one and add 1 to it.
